Recent photos showcasing supposed cryptids have ignited a fierce debate across the cryptozoology community. As people weigh in, the authenticity of these images is being hotly contested, with some claiming they simply represent familiar marine life misidentified as cryptids.
In response to the images, many in the forum noted potential misidentifications. One commentator asserted that image number three depicts a whale shark rather than a cryptid, recalling insights from an older shark book. Another user confidently identified image seven as a coelacanth, emphasizing its historical significance if true. As one user remarked, "#7 is absolutely a coelacanth nothing else looks even remotely close to that."
In a twist, the community discussions reveal that some images originate from obscure online content dating back to 2007-2010. A user mentioned an older article in the Bennington Banner from 1968 that allegedly showed a cow claimed to be a new breed, which adds another layer to the sourcing debate.
Diverse opinions floated among the commenters. Concerns bubbled up around the identity of the supposed barracuda in image ten, which was swiftly identified as a tuna by multiple people. As one put it, "The 'barracuda' is a tuna; tuna grow much larger than barracudas." This revelation sparked further dialogue about identity issues regarding what constitutes a true cryptid.
